Terms and rules

Eligibility:

We welcome all works from the community in New York and the global community with a focus on works by or about Asian Americans.

Submission Guidelines:
1. Film entrants must submit through FilmFreeway/CTAF
2. Each film must be in English spoken language or with English subtitle
3. All submissions shall also include a brief bio of the artists, a short description of the film and marketing images including but not limited to still images, posters, trailers, audio and written information (the “Film Materials”)
